Ad image

Fungsi Swap RAM: Meningkatkan Kapasitas Memori

Ahmad Hidayat
Ahmad Hidayat

Fungsi swap ram – Swap RAM, sebuah fitur yang sering dianggap misterius, berperan penting dalam menjaga kelancaran kinerja komputer. Bayangkan sebuah komputer dengan kapasitas RAM terbatas, seperti sebuah ruangan kecil yang penuh dengan barang. Saat Anda ingin menambahkan barang baru, Anda membutuhkan tempat tambahan. Di sinilah swap RAM hadir sebagai gudang penyimpanan sementara, layaknya sebuah ruangan besar di luar ruangan kecil Anda.

Swap RAM berfungsi sebagai ruang penyimpanan virtual, memanfaatkan hard disk sebagai ekstensi dari RAM. Ketika RAM penuh, data yang jarang digunakan akan dipindahkan ke swap space di hard disk, sehingga ruang di RAM dapat digunakan untuk data yang sedang aktif. Proses ini mirip dengan menyingkirkan barang-barang yang jarang digunakan ke gudang, sehingga Anda memiliki ruang kosong di ruangan kecil Anda untuk barang-barang yang lebih sering Anda gunakan.

Pengertian Swap RAM

Fungsi swap ram

Swap RAM, atau yang lebih dikenal sebagai swap space, adalah sebuah fitur dalam sistem operasi yang memungkinkan komputer untuk menggunakan ruang hard disk sebagai RAM tambahan. Hal ini terjadi ketika RAM utama sudah penuh, dan sistem operasi membutuhkan lebih banyak ruang untuk menjalankan program dan menyimpan data. Swap space berperan sebagai ruang penyimpanan sementara yang memungkinkan sistem operasi untuk memindahkan data yang tidak aktif dari RAM ke hard disk.

Bayangkan sebuah meja kerja Anda yang sudah penuh dengan berbagai dokumen dan alat tulis. Anda ingin membuka dokumen baru, namun meja kerja Anda sudah penuh. Anda kemudian memutuskan untuk menyimpan beberapa dokumen yang tidak sedang Anda gunakan ke dalam sebuah kotak di bawah meja. Kotak ini berperan sebagai swap space, yang memungkinkan Anda untuk membuka dokumen baru dengan memindahkan beberapa dokumen yang tidak aktif ke dalam kotak tersebut. Begitu Anda membutuhkan dokumen yang disimpan di kotak, Anda dapat mengambilnya kembali ke meja kerja Anda.

Perbedaan RAM dan Swap Space

Fitur RAM Swap Space
Lokasi Chip memori di motherboard Ruang kosong pada hard disk
Kecepatan Akses Sangat cepat Relatif lambat
Kapasitas Terbatas Lebih besar, tergantung kapasitas hard disk
Biaya Lebih mahal Lebih murah

Cara Kerja Swap RAM

Linux

Swap RAM, atau sering disebut sebagai swap file atau swap space, merupakan area penyimpanan pada hard disk yang digunakan sebagai perluasan memori RAM. Ketika RAM penuh, sistem operasi akan memindahkan data yang jarang digunakan dari RAM ke swap file, sehingga ruang RAM yang kosong dapat digunakan untuk data yang lebih aktif. Swap RAM berfungsi sebagai solusi sementara untuk mengatasi keterbatasan RAM, namun perlu diingat bahwa proses ini lebih lambat daripada akses langsung ke RAM.

Langkah-langkah Cara Kerja Swap RAM

Proses swap RAM melibatkan beberapa langkah yang terjadi di latar belakang sistem operasi. Berikut adalah langkah-langkah detailnya:

  1. Memeriksa Ketersediaan RAM: Ketika aplikasi atau proses membutuhkan lebih banyak RAM daripada yang tersedia, sistem operasi akan memeriksa apakah masih ada ruang kosong di RAM. Jika tidak, sistem operasi akan mencari ruang kosong di swap file.
  2. Memindahkan Data ke Swap File: Sistem operasi akan memilih data yang jarang digunakan dari RAM dan memindahkannya ke swap file. Data ini mungkin termasuk bagian dari program, data yang tidak digunakan, atau buffer yang jarang diakses.
  3. Mengosongkan Ruang RAM: Setelah data dipindahkan ke swap file, ruang RAM yang kosong akan tersedia untuk digunakan oleh aplikasi atau proses yang membutuhkannya.
  4. Mengakses Data dari Swap File: Ketika aplikasi atau proses membutuhkan data yang telah dipindahkan ke swap file, sistem operasi akan mengambil data tersebut dari swap file dan memindahkannya kembali ke RAM.

Diagram Alir Proses Swap RAM, Fungsi swap ram

Berikut adalah diagram alir yang menggambarkan proses swap RAM:

[Diagram Alir]

Diagram alir menunjukkan proses swap RAM mulai dari permintaan memori oleh aplikasi, pemeriksaan ketersediaan RAM, pemindahan data ke swap file, pengosongan ruang RAM, dan akses data dari swap file.

Contoh Ilustrasi Cara Kerja Swap RAM

Misalnya, Anda membuka beberapa aplikasi sekaligus, seperti browser web, editor teks, dan program musik. Ketika RAM penuh, sistem operasi mungkin akan memindahkan beberapa tab browser yang jarang digunakan atau data dari editor teks yang tidak aktif ke swap file. Ketika Anda mengklik tab browser yang telah dipindahkan ke swap file, sistem operasi akan mengambil data tersebut dari swap file dan memindahkannya kembali ke RAM, sehingga tab browser tersebut dapat ditampilkan kembali.

Keuntungan dan Kerugian Swap RAM

Fungsi swap ram

Swap RAM adalah sebuah mekanisme yang memungkinkan sistem operasi untuk menggunakan ruang penyimpanan hard drive sebagai RAM tambahan. Ketika RAM fisik sudah penuh, sistem operasi akan memindahkan data yang jarang digunakan dari RAM ke ruang swap di hard drive. Hal ini memungkinkan sistem operasi untuk terus menjalankan program dan aplikasi, meskipun RAM fisik sudah penuh.

Keuntungan Swap RAM

Penggunaan swap RAM memiliki beberapa keuntungan, di antaranya:

  • Memungkinkan sistem operasi untuk menjalankan program dan aplikasi yang lebih banyak daripada yang bisa ditampung oleh RAM fisik.
  • Membantu sistem operasi untuk menghindari kehabisan memori, yang dapat menyebabkan kinerja sistem melambat atau bahkan crash.
  • Meningkatkan kemampuan multitasking, karena sistem operasi dapat memindahkan data yang tidak aktif ke ruang swap dan membebaskan RAM untuk aplikasi yang aktif.

Kerugian Swap RAM

Meskipun swap RAM memiliki beberapa keuntungan, namun penggunaan swap RAM juga memiliki beberapa kerugian, di antaranya:

  • Kinerja sistem akan melambat, karena hard drive jauh lebih lambat daripada RAM. Memindahkan data dari RAM ke ruang swap dan sebaliknya akan memakan waktu, sehingga proses akan menjadi lebih lambat.
  • Membebani hard drive. Hard drive akan bekerja lebih keras untuk memproses data swap, yang dapat menyebabkan keausan hard drive lebih cepat.
  • Meningkatkan konsumsi daya. Proses swap membutuhkan daya yang lebih banyak daripada proses RAM biasa, sehingga dapat memperpendek masa pakai baterai pada perangkat mobile.

Tabel Perbandingan

Aspek Keuntungan Kerugian
Kinerja Meningkatkan kemampuan multitasking Menurunkan kinerja sistem
Ketahanan Membantu sistem operasi untuk menghindari kehabisan memori Membebani hard drive, memperpendek masa pakai hard drive
Konsumsi Daya Tidak ada Meningkatkan konsumsi daya

Faktor yang Mempengaruhi Swap RAM

Penggunaan swap RAM adalah mekanisme penting dalam sistem operasi untuk mengelola memori. Namun, penggunaan swap RAM yang berlebihan dapat berdampak negatif pada kinerja sistem. Ada beberapa faktor yang dapat memengaruhi penggunaan swap RAM, dan memahami faktor-faktor ini sangat penting untuk mengoptimalkan kinerja sistem.

Jumlah RAM yang Tersedia

Salah satu faktor utama yang memengaruhi penggunaan swap RAM adalah jumlah RAM yang tersedia. Jika RAM yang tersedia tidak cukup untuk menjalankan semua program dan proses yang sedang berjalan, sistem operasi akan mulai menggunakan swap RAM. Semakin kecil jumlah RAM yang tersedia, semakin besar kemungkinan sistem operasi akan menggunakan swap RAM.

Jumlah Program yang Dibuka

Jumlah program yang dibuka secara bersamaan juga dapat memengaruhi penggunaan swap RAM. Jika Anda membuka banyak program sekaligus, terutama program yang membutuhkan banyak memori, sistem operasi mungkin akan mulai menggunakan swap RAM untuk menyimpan data yang tidak aktif.

Ukuran File Swap

Ukuran file swap juga memengaruhi penggunaan swap RAM. File swap adalah file khusus pada hard disk yang digunakan untuk menyimpan data yang tidak aktif. Semakin besar ukuran file swap, semakin banyak data yang dapat disimpan di dalamnya. Namun, jika ukuran file swap terlalu kecil, sistem operasi mungkin akan kehabisan ruang dan mulai menggunakan swap RAM lebih sering.

Aktivitas Disk

Aktivitas disk juga dapat memengaruhi penggunaan swap RAM. Jika hard disk sedang digunakan secara intensif, misalnya untuk membaca atau menulis file besar, sistem operasi mungkin akan menggunakan swap RAM untuk menyimpan data yang tidak aktif. Ini karena hard disk lebih lambat daripada RAM, sehingga menggunakan swap RAM dapat membantu mempercepat kinerja sistem.

Kinerja CPU

Kinerja CPU juga dapat memengaruhi penggunaan swap RAM. Jika CPU sedang digunakan secara intensif, sistem operasi mungkin akan menggunakan swap RAM untuk menyimpan data yang tidak aktif. Ini karena CPU lebih sibuk memproses data yang aktif, sehingga menggunakan swap RAM dapat membantu mengurangi beban CPU.

Cara Mengoptimalkan Swap RAM: Fungsi Swap Ram

Swap RAM, atau sering disebut sebagai file swap, adalah ruang penyimpanan pada hard disk yang digunakan sebagai alternatif memori fisik (RAM) ketika RAM penuh. Ketika sistem operasi kehabisan RAM, ia akan memindahkan data yang tidak aktif dari RAM ke swap space. Meskipun swap space dapat membantu meningkatkan kinerja sistem, penggunaan swap space yang berlebihan dapat memperlambat kinerja sistem secara signifikan. Oleh karena itu, mengoptimalkan penggunaan swap RAM sangat penting untuk menjaga kinerja sistem tetap optimal.

Cara Mengatur Ukuran Swap Space

Ukuran swap space yang optimal bergantung pada jumlah RAM yang tersedia dan kebutuhan sistem. Secara umum, ukuran swap space yang disarankan adalah dua kali lipat dari jumlah RAM. Namun, Anda dapat menyesuaikan ukuran swap space berdasarkan kebutuhan Anda.

  • Jika Anda memiliki RAM yang cukup besar, Anda dapat mengurangi ukuran swap space.
  • Jika Anda sering menggunakan aplikasi yang membutuhkan banyak RAM, Anda dapat meningkatkan ukuran swap space.

Tips dan Trik Mengoptimalkan Penggunaan Swap RAM

Berikut adalah beberapa tips dan trik untuk mengoptimalkan penggunaan swap RAM:

  • Tutup Aplikasi yang Tidak Digunakan: Mematikan aplikasi yang tidak digunakan akan membebaskan RAM dan mengurangi penggunaan swap space.
  • Bersihkan File Sampah: File sampah dapat memakan ruang disk dan mengurangi ruang swap space yang tersedia. Bersihkan file sampah secara berkala untuk meningkatkan kinerja sistem.
  • Defragmentasi Hard Disk: Defragmentasi hard disk dapat membantu meningkatkan kinerja sistem dengan mengatur file yang terfragmentasi. Defragmentasi hard disk juga dapat meningkatkan kinerja swap space.
  • Gunakan Aplikasi Manajemen Memori: Beberapa aplikasi manajemen memori dapat membantu mengoptimalkan penggunaan RAM dan mengurangi penggunaan swap space. Aplikasi ini dapat membantu mengidentifikasi dan menutup aplikasi yang menggunakan banyak RAM.
  • Tingkatkan Jumlah RAM: Cara paling efektif untuk mengurangi penggunaan swap space adalah dengan meningkatkan jumlah RAM yang tersedia.

Langkah-langkah untuk Meminimalkan Penggunaan Swap RAM

Berikut adalah beberapa langkah yang dapat dilakukan untuk meminimalkan penggunaan swap RAM:

  • Monitor Penggunaan RAM: Gunakan Task Manager atau alat pemantauan sistem lainnya untuk memantau penggunaan RAM.
  • Identifikasi Aplikasi yang Menggunakan Banyak RAM: Setelah Anda mengetahui aplikasi yang menggunakan banyak RAM, Anda dapat menutup aplikasi tersebut atau mencari alternatif yang lebih ringan.
  • Atur Prioritas Aplikasi: Anda dapat mengatur prioritas aplikasi yang paling penting agar aplikasi tersebut mendapatkan akses ke RAM lebih dulu.
  • Gunakan Aplikasi yang Lebih Ringan: Jika Anda menggunakan aplikasi yang berat, cobalah untuk mencari alternatif yang lebih ringan.
  • Gunakan Browser yang Lebih Ringan: Beberapa browser web lebih ringan daripada yang lain.

Kesimpulan Akhir

Meskipun swap RAM memberikan solusi untuk mengatasi keterbatasan RAM, penggunaannya memiliki dampak pada kinerja sistem. Penggunaan swap space yang berlebihan dapat menyebabkan penurunan kecepatan komputer, karena akses data dari hard disk lebih lambat dibandingkan dengan RAM. Oleh karena itu, penting untuk mengoptimalkan penggunaan swap RAM dengan cara meningkatkan kapasitas RAM, menutup program yang tidak diperlukan, dan mengatur ukuran swap space secara efektif.

Kumpulan FAQ

Apakah swap RAM hanya untuk komputer dengan RAM kecil?

Tidak, semua komputer memiliki swap RAM, meskipun RAM yang dimiliki cukup besar. Namun, komputer dengan RAM kecil cenderung lebih sering menggunakan swap RAM.

Apakah swap RAM berbahaya untuk komputer?

Tidak, swap RAM bukanlah sesuatu yang berbahaya. Namun, penggunaan swap space yang berlebihan dapat menyebabkan penurunan kinerja komputer.

Bagaimana cara mengetahui penggunaan swap RAM?

Anda dapat melihat penggunaan swap RAM melalui Task Manager di Windows atau Activity Monitor di macOS.

Share This Article